RING-CAKE (TWIST) FROM AVLANGRUD FARM

4 cups all-purpose flour
3 1/2 tbsp. sugar
5 1/2 oz. margarine
2 1/2 tbsp. yeast
1/2 tbsp. salt
1 tbsp. cardamom
1 egg
2 oz. raisins
3/4 cup tepid milk

Filling:
4 1/2 oz. margarine
4 1/2 tbsp. sugar

   
 

Submitted by Berit Stabo-Eeg

Make a yeast dough and put it away to rise in a warm place for 20 minutes. Roll it out and form it into a long roll, flatten with rolling pin or with the hand. Mix margarine (softened) with sugar. Spread this filling all over the roll. Sprinkle with raisins and chopped, candied citron, and chopped almonds for extra taste, if desired.

Roll together and form into a twist on a baking sheet, put away to rise once again. Brush with egg white, sprinkle with granulated sugar and chopped almonds. Bake for 20 minutes in a hot oven (400-450 degrees F).


Recipe taken from Norwegian Home Cooking by Rikke and Nils Lie published and sold by Hedmarksmuseet, 2300 Hamar, Norway.
